Abstract

This research presents a new spectrophotometric method used to determine mebendazole using oxidation and coupling reaction. This method is based on using potassium chromate as an oxidizing agent for catechol, which is then combined with imibendazole to form a stable product with brown color. The highest absorption is achieved at 402 nm. Moreover, absorbance coefficient is 1556.0794 l.mol-1.cm-1. Beer's law limits were (4-140) µg/ml.
